International Delegations Visit DAAI for Sustainability and Humanitarian Exchange

Distinguished guests from several international organizations — including Caritas Freetown, Healey International Relief Foundation, and the World Faiths Development Dialogue at the Berkley Center for Religion, Peace, and World Affairs, Georgetown University — visited DAAI prior to attending Tzu Chi’s 60th anniversary celebrations.

Through presentations and interactive exchanges, the visiting delegates gained deeper insight into DAAI’s practices in environmental sustainability, circular economy initiatives, and humanistic values rooted in compassion. The visit highlighted how environmental action can be integrated with humanitarian care, transforming sustainability into a meaningful force for social good.

This gathering of international organizations and cross-cultural partners not only fostered dialogue on humanitarian service and social responsibility, but also strengthened shared aspirations for future collaboration. By coming together through common values of compassion and sustainability, participants expressed hope to continue walking side by side — uniting greater forces of goodness to bring warmth, care, and hope to communities around the world.

DAAI remains committed to building bridges across cultures and sectors, believing that when compassion and action converge, sustainable impact can extend far beyond borders.
